Keyfactor for Government
Keyfactor lists Keyfactor for Government on the FedRAMP Marketplace with the status FedRAMP Certified, at Moderate impact, on the Agency path under the Rev5 process. Package FR2335051964, read from the marketplace feed as of September 3, 2026.

The marketplace carries Keyfactor for Government under package FR2335051964 with 19 recorded fields. Its certification date is May 13, 2026. Fortreum, LLC is named as the independent assessor, with an annual assessment date of February 24, 2011. 1 agency is listed as having authorized it, among them Department of State. It is delivered as SaaS on a government community cloud, filed under 10 business categories including Communication, Cybersecurity & Risk Management, Data Management and 7 more. Its SAM.gov unique entity identifier is PD9UTGRAF852.

Section H. Description
As published on the marketplace
The provider's own description of the service, reproduced from the FedRAMP feed without edits.
Keyfactor for Government is delivered as a SaaS offering using a multi-tenant Government Community cloud computing environment. The Keyfactor for Government cloud service offering provides a Certificate Lifecycle Automation and Management (CLAaaS) solution for US Federal Departments and Agencies to manage digital certificate lifecycle across their enterprise. Keyfactor for Government enables Certificate Lifecycle Automation and Management through our Keyfactor Command web-based console, which simplifies and organizes certificate inventory, alerting and reporting, issuance, and automation. Our solution provides visibility and management of all public and private certificates in use across the customer's on-premise and cloud environments and enables workflow automations to prevent outages due to expired certificates. Keyfactor for Government allows you to: - Securely connect to your on-premise Microsoft or EJBCA Certificate Authority and/or to public CAs from Entrust, DigiCert, or Sectigo. - Inventory certificates across your enterprise and/or cloud environments. - Automate the issuance and deployment of certificates
